    I know this is the bowhunting section, and this is kind of a gun/muzzloading question, so if the mods need to delete it thats ok. And yes, I do have it in the midwest area, and the deer hunting area. Anyways, here is my question.
    For the past 10 years, I have hunted a small 15 acre spot of private land, I have had it all to myself the whole time. This are is Hunters Choice. I have just gained permission on an additional 60 acres about 40 miles North of here, this place is Lottery, meaning I have to send in and apply for a doe tag. I usually archery hunt the archery season and then if I still don't have a deer, I buy a gun license. Then I go back to the bow until our Muzzleloader season starts. This new spot will mainly be a spot for gun season, and muzzleloader season. My question is, if I apply for a doe tag, for the new spot, can I still gun hunt my old hunters choice spot. I understand that I would have to make sure to use the right tags, for that area.

    I guess long story short, I will be applying for a doe tag in area 232. So, if I don't draw a doe tag, can I shoot a doe in my hunters choice area, if I chooses to hunt this area a couple days?
